911 Turbo AWD F6-3600cc 3.6L SOHC Twin Turbo (1997)
Blower Motor Resistor: Testing and Inspection
Checking Ballast Resistor of Rear Blower
NOTE: The ballast resistor is fitted with a restart lockout device. This restart lockout may be bypassed if the 1St stage of the rear blower should fail
(2nd stage of rear blower operates continuously).
1. Take out ballast resistor.
2. Press down spring plate with a needle or a similar tool. This causes the contact tongue to snap back into its initial position.
3. Replace the ballast resistor if the contacts are burnt.
